Determine the values that are excluded in the following expressions.$$\frac{x-3}{x^{2}+12}$$
Step 1
So, we need to solve the equation: x^2 + 12 = 0 x^2 = -12 Since there is no real number whose square is a negative number, there are no real values of x that would make the denominator equal to 0. Show more…
